(7S,9S)-6,9,11-trihydroxy-9-(2-hydroxyacetyl)-7-[(2R,4S,5S,6S)-5-hydroxy-4-[(2S)-2-methoxymorpholin-4-yl]-6-methyloxan-2-yl]oxy-4-methoxy-8,10-dihydro-7H-tetracene-5,12-dione
Also Known As: Nemorubicin, nemorubicina, nemorubicine, nemorubicinum, Nemorubicinol

| Molecular Formula | C32H37NO13 |
| Molecular Weight | 643.2265 g/mol |
| XLogP | 1.7 |
| Topological Polar Surface Area (TPSA) | 202.0 Ų |
| Hydrogen Bond Donors | 5 |
| Hydrogen Bond Acceptors | 14 |
| Rotatable Bonds | 7 |
| Exact Mass | 643.2265 Da |
| Heavy Atoms | 46 |
| Complexity | 1160.0 |
| SMILES | C[C@H]1[C@H]([C@H](C[C@@H](O1)O[C@H]2C[C@@](CC3=C2C(=C4C(=C3O)C(=O)C5=C(C4=O)C(=CC=C5)OC)O)(C(=O)CO)O)N6CCO[C@@H](C6)OC)O |
| InChIKey | CTMCWCONSULRHO-UHQPFXKFSA-N |
The XLogP value of 1.7 suggests moderate lipophilicity, balancing water solubility and membrane permeability for Nemorubicin. The TPSA of 202.0 Ų indicates high polarity, suggesting Nemorubicin may have limited membrane permeability but good aqueous solubility. Following Lipinski's Rule of Five, Nemorubicin has 5 hydrogen bond donor(s) and 14 hydrogen bond acceptor(s), which may warrant consideration for formulation optimization.
